Dappled Appellation Chardonnay 2025
A blend of upper and lower Yarra Vineyards - Clones P58, I10V1 and Dijon clones 76 and 95 - from vineyards in St Andrews, Steels Creek and Seville. All fruit is hand-picked and cooled overnight, followed by whole bunches being lightly crushed by foot before a long pressing when the un-sulphured juice is transferred straight to oak. The oak is a combination of 80% old and 20% new French Barriques, Puncheons and Demi-Muids. Ferments are allowed to start naturally (wild) and complete with no temperature control. The wine is not battonaged and left on lees for 10 months where some MLF may have occurred, but not encouraged, and SO2 is added when the wine is ready for it. The wine is lightly filtered before being bottled un-fined
'Dappled does it again.
This wine is both seriously impressive and seriously delicious. It tastes of grapefruit, pear, citrus, peach and whispers of both cedar and flint. But it’s the wine as a whole, and its cohesion, and its general juiciness that is the main take, and the main attraction. Every sip of this wine makes you want another. There’s a chalky-steeliness to the finish and plenty of fruit there too. In summary, it’s bang on.'
94 Points - Campbell Mattinson, The Wine Front
